The Building Regulations for Garage Conversions in Washington

Building Regulations Garage Conversion Washington (NE37)

If you could use an extra room in your property in Washington, perhaps for home working, or to provide a relative with some independent living space, have you thought about transforming your garage? A straightforward converting of your current garage into a living space does not usually require planning permission from the local authorities, however you will have to follow the appropriate building regulations.

Such elements as ventilation, insulation, electrical systems, drainage and fire safety are going to be covered by the building regulations relating to garage conversions. Your local building control office will be happy to offer guidance on garage conversion guidelines for Washington and provide a full checklist of regulations that need to be observed.

A professional builder in Washington will assist you with the building regulations process and inform you if you should submit a Full Plan Submission or a basic Building Notice to your local council offices. In most cases your building contractor will prepare the plans for a Full Plan Submission, however this could take as much as eight weeks to be approved, which when compared with two or three days for approval from a Building Notice may swing your decision on which application to send in.

Converting a Double Garage

There are a few ways in which a double garage conversion is different from a single garage conversion. The primary divergence, understandably, is the magnitude of the space that's being converted. A double garage conversion will generally provide a larger area for living space than would result from a single garage conversion. The greater amount of space allows for more flexibility in the conversion's layout, intended functions and design. Furthermore, a double garage may need more extensive reconstruction work, as there might be 2 separate garage doors and walls that need removing or replacing. This could also demand more intricate structural work to ensure that the new living space is safe and structurally sound.

The conversion's costs are another aspect to be aware of. Because a double garage conversion is often a bigger undertaking undertaking than converting a single garage, it typically costs more due to the added materials and labour required. To conclude, a double garage conversion can provide a substantial increase in living space and flexibility, but it might require more extensive work, planning, and financial investment than converting a single garage. There are several potential uses for a double garage conversion, including: a guest bedroom or guest suite, an entertainment area or games room, a home study or office, additional living space for a growing family, a craft room or workshop or a fitness studio or home gym.

Floors for Garage Conversions

Washington Tyne and Wear Garage Conversion Floors

One of the major concerns when doing a conversion on your garage is the floor. Most garages have got concrete floors and most likely you will not want to have this for your final surface in a new living space. In addition garage floors usually have a gentle downward incline toward the doorway, so will have to be levelled. Floors are generally 4" lower than the house when the garage is connected to the main building. This additional space can be useful for underfloor heating, insulation, a wooden floor surface and pipework, if you decide on a floating floor. The floor could then be finished using tiles, vinyl flooring, carpet, solid wood or laminate flooring. Soundproofing

The consideration of soundproofing is essential for individuals seeking to transform their garage into a functional living space. Soundproofing measures, in place to ensure a quiet and peaceful environment, effectively shield the converted area from external noises and prevent sound leakage.

A converted garage can benefit from the implementation of several effective strategies for sound insulation. Within the walls and ceiling, the installation of insulation materials, such as acoustic foam panels, can effectively dampen and absorb sound vibrations.

Double-glazed windows, when fitted with laminated glass, contribute to a greater reduction in external noise penetration. Sound leaks can be prevented by sealing gaps or cracks with weatherstripping and acoustic sealant. Adding soundproof curtains or mass-loaded vinyl can provide an extra sound barrier.

A comfortable and tranquil living space, free from unwelcome noise disturbances, can be achieved by implementing these soundproofing strategies in a garage conversion.

Do I Need Planning Permission for a Garage Conversion?

In the UK, the need for planning permission for a garage conversion hinges on specific circumstances. However, numerous garage conversions fall under the category of "permitted development rights," enabling them to proceed without formal planning permission, given that certain conditions are met. These conditions include:

  • The conversion should not increase the number of bedrooms in the dwelling beyond four.
  • The converted space should be used for purposes aligned with residential use, such as adding a sleeping area, establishing a work area, or extending the living space.
  • The property's exterior appearance should not undergo substantial modifications.
  • The building's physical presence should not encroach upon any additional land (increase its footprint).

Bear in mind that local planning authorities may impose their own guidelines and limitations, so it's prudent to consult with them or seek professional guidance to ensure compliance. In cases where the conversion falls short of the permitted development criteria, planning permission is required, which can involve a more elaborate process and potential fees. It's crucial to stay abreast of the latest regulations and consult with local authorities for specific guidelines.

Half-Garage Conversions Washington

When looking at the prospects for converting a garage in Washington, there could possibly be some circumstances where your local authority will refuse your "change of use" application. If you live in an area of special interest, in a conservation area, in a listed building or on a new housing estate, this could very easily be a problem.

Homes that are located on newer housing estates are the ones which are most often refused permission, due to the fact that the local council have rules about retaining the current number of garage spaces, or simply do not want to change the appearance of the estate.

In circumstances like this it is going to be more about the exterior appearance of your garage doorway, and so long as you do not change this then there shouldn't be too much of a problem. A "half-garage" conversion could be the answer here, and you can leave the doorway and a part of the garage the same, and convert the end half of it into a children's playroom, utility room or home office, to create that practical extra living space.

If you have limited funds, this option also has the advantage that it is less expensive than a full garage conversion, which could make it even more attractive.

Garage Conversions - The Costs

Washington Tyne and Wear Garage Conversion

One of the principal advantages of remodeling your garage to get further living space in your house is that it's by far the cheapest approach. A normal garage conversion will cost you about £1,000-£1,250 per square metre, which means that you ought to be able to complete the whole conversion for under £8-10,000 (contingent on the dimensions of the garage). You could compare this to something like £40-45,000 for a loft conversion or brick extension. Of course the space that is created is limited somewhat although is by no means insignificant. it could be easily used for a spare lounge, a bedroom, a kid's play room or a kitchen. Precisely what the cost of a garage conversion is depends on not just your garage's area but the scale of the work that has to be carried out to complete it. This is going to include criteria such as whether or not the ceiling needs raising, whether or not the walls, roof and floor are sound, whether or not a structural engineer is needed, the extent of design and planning fees and whether the footings need reinforcing.
